Nokia 2.1 is a bit better than the Alcatel OneTouch POP D5, getting a 58.4 score against 53.3. The Nokia 2.1 construction is somewhat heavier but a little thinner than Alcatel OneTouch POP D5. These phones work with Android OS, but Nokia 2.1 has 9.0 Pie version and Alcatel OneTouch POP D5 has Android 4.4 version, so it provides a couple additional features and performance improvements.
Alcatel OneTouch POP D5 has a little sharper screen than Nokia 2.1, although it has a quite smaller display, a lot worse resolution of 854 x 480px and a bit less pixels per inch in the display. The Nokia 2.1 counts with a lot bigger memory to store more apps and games than Alcatel OneTouch POP D5, because it has 8 GB internal storage and an external memory slot that allows a maximum of 128 GB.
Nokia 2.1 has a bit more powerful processing unit than Alcatel OneTouch POP D5, and although they both have the same number of cores, the Nokia 2.1 also has 512 MB more RAM memory. The Nokia 2.1 has a much better battery duration than Alcatel OneTouch POP D5, because it has a 122 percent more battery capacity.
Nokia 2.1 shoots much better photographs and videos than Alcatel OneTouch POP D5, because it has a way better (Full HD) video resolution and a camera in the back with way more mega-pixels.
Despite of being the best phone in our comparison, the Nokia 2.1 is also by far the cheapest one, making it very easy to pick between these devices.
